The article focuses on the three papers that provide information on how cytoplasmic ATPase SecA moves polypeptides through the SecY channel. Zimmer and members analyze the crystal structure of SecY that are associated with SecY complexes. On the same arrangement, Tsukazaki and group discover the hydrophobic crevasse promoted by the expansion of anti-SecY Fab fragments. Erlandson and associates investigate the helix finger-like structure that protrudes from SecA into the cytoplasmic funnel.
